How to choose the right name for a dog?
Friends When it comes to choosing a name for your furry friend, it’s important to consider what will be easiest for them to hear and distinguish. Dogs tend to respond better to names that have hard consonants and long vowels. So, names like “Lucky” or “Benny” would be great choices.
Most dog training experts suggest going for a name that is one or two syllables long, making it easier for you to say quickly. It’s also a good idea to avoid male dog names that sound like commands. For instance, names like “Kit” might sound too similar to “sit,” or “Bo” might sound like “no.”
The name you choose should be something you genuinely like saying, and something you won’t feel embarrassed about shouting across the park or putting on a dog ID tag. Remember, you’ll be using your boy puppy’s name a lot over time, whether it’s to grab their attention or as part of their training and socialization. So, pick a name that brings a smile to your face and suits your furry buddy perfectly.
